Product descriptions deserve close attention. Materials, dimensions, framing, finish, production method, and care instructions can significantly affect the value of an artwork. A print and an original piece may look similar in a thumbnail while offering very different ownership experiences. Likewise, a decorative object intended for indoor display may require different handling from a functional creative tool. Reading the full specification before applying a coupon helps prevent a discount from encouraging a purchase that is unsuitable for the intended space.

Delivery and returns to consider
Shipping is a central consideration for art purchases because products may be fragile, oversized, framed, or made to order. Delivery charges can vary according to dimensions and destination, and protective packaging may influence the final cost. Before payment, review the estimated dispatch and delivery information, particularly if the item is intended for a birthday, event, renovation, or other fixed occasion.
When an order arrives, inspect the outer packaging before disposing of it. Photographing visible damage and retaining the packing materials can make a return or claim easier if the item has been affected in transit. For framed or delicate work, check the corners, surface, hanging hardware, and glazing carefully. A product that appears acceptable at first glance may still have damage that becomes more noticeable under direct light.
Return policies deserve special attention because not every art purchase is equally easy to send back. Standard, unused merchandise is generally simpler to return than personalized, commissioned, opened, or made-to-order work. A shopper should confirm the allowed return period, condition requirements, refund method, and responsibility for return shipping before ordering a piece with a substantial value. This is also important when a coupon was used, since the refund calculation may follow the original order terms.

Artistic products can involve subjective judgments about color, texture, scale, and finish. Screen settings may also affect how colors appear online. For that reason, buyers should use measurements, material descriptions, and customer images where available instead of relying on a product photograph alone.
